Common Pitfalls
Don't Ask About Specific Cases
Avoid asking about specific cases or decisions. Judges cannot discuss ongoing cases or provide legal advice.
Avoid Controversial Topics
Don't ask about controversial political or legal issues. Focus on the role and responsibilities of being a judge.
